Corcoran — The City Council opened public hearings and adopted three routine resolutions certifying delinquent charges to Hennepin County.
At the meeting the council opened public hearings for: certification of delinquent recycling charges, certification of delinquent water and sewer utility fees, and certification of delinquent escrow account balances. For each item staff opened and the council closed the public hearing and then moved to adopt the corresponding resolution.
The council adopted:
- Resolution 2025‑91, certifying delinquent recycling charges to Hennepin County.
- Resolution 2025‑92, certifying delinquent water and sewer utility fees to Hennepin County.
- Resolution 2025‑93, certifying delinquent escrow account balances to Hennepin County.
Each resolution was moved, seconded and adopted by voice vote; the transcript records the motions and the council’s voice votes but does not include detailed roll‑call tallies for these items. Staff has responsibility to forward the certified lists to Hennepin County for collection.
